## Schema migrations — zero downtime

For Orvane releases: expand first, migrate, contract later. Never drop a column in the same release that stops writing it. Run the backfill worker before flipping reads. Verify replica lag under two seconds before the contract phase. Abort if lock wait exceeds the budget. The migration runner picks up its limits from the values below.

config for tajof-yaguf:
[istox]
team = aldius
access_code = ac_29be1b
owner = holok.praix
host = istox.zarqelsoft.test
port = 11211
peer = novath.olvarqio.example
salt = 983a9dc6
pin = 4652

**Ticket VLT-2291: Export retries blocked by locked vault**

The Quillstone export worker retries failed jobs every 15 minutes, but retries stall because the signing vault locked after three bad attempts. No data loss; jobs are queued. Requesting security review before unlock—audit log attached to this ticket. Once approved, the on-call engineer should open the vault with the passphrase below.

vault phrase of yafog-yaweg = sorwyn-istax

Heads up: the Quillbook spreadsheet export job balloons in memory when workbooks exceed 40 sheets, so the exporter pods on the Fennmore cluster get OOM-killed mid-release. If that happens, the export service account sometimes locks itself after repeated restarts. Don't panic — just re-run the recovery flow from the admin shell, bump the pod memory limit to 6Gi, and when prompted for credentials, enter the recovery passphrase shown below.

unlock words, yawig-kagef: gordor-holvan-ulaael-pramir-ulaiel-tamdor